- Food & Beverages
- Maidenhead
- MAJESTIC
- Directions
Directions to the business MAJESTIC - Maidenhead
Related companies
8B High Street Mall, Nicholson Shopping Centre
Maidenhead - BE - SL6 1LB
53 High Street, The Nicholsons Centre , 82 Queens Walk Mall
Maidenhead - BE - SL6 1LB